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
13 9508 912 76219024
34 0015610
34 0015610
13 170258 630176
All about undefined
Interested in learning more?
34 0015610
13 170258 630176
See more
9811 25946
11 57308 79 311368893 6354
See more
18 681
2796 11129717797 3797726
See more